What Is a Criminal Paralegal?

A criminal paralegal ⁤ assists lawyers in preparing​ cases‍ related to criminal law. Their roles include conducting legal research, organizing case files, preparing documentation, and sometimes liaising with clients or witnesses. While they don’t provide legal advice,criminal paralegals are integral to case planning and progression.

Key Responsibilities in Criminal Paralegal Vacancies

  • Legal Research: Gathering relevant ⁤laws,​ precedents, and legal articles related to criminal cases.
  • Drafting Documents: Preparing subpoenas, affidavits, and legal summaries.
  • Case Management: Organizing and maintaining case files, evidence, and documentation.
  • Client Interaction: Communicating with clients under lawyer supervision,scheduling ‌appointments.
  • Preparing for Court: Assisting with trial preparation, including‍ exhibit institution and witness coordination.

Skills and Qualifications for Criminal Paralegal Positions

Employers look for specific skills ​and qualifications in criminal paralegal candidates. Typical requirements include:

  • Educational background: ‌ an associate’s degree in ⁣paralegal studies or ​a bachelor’s degree in criminal justice is frequently enough preferred.
  • Legal Knowledge: Understanding of criminal procedures, legal terminology, and ⁤case law.
  • Research Skills: Ability to quickly and accurately find⁢ relevant legal details.
  • Organization: managing multiple cases and ⁤deadlines efficiently.
  • Communication Skills: Clear and professional interaction with clients, witnesses, and attorneys.

Practical⁣ Tips for Landing ‌criminal ​Paralegal Vacancies

1. Build Relevant Experience

Internships, volunteering at legal clinics, or⁢ assistant roles can make‍ your resume stand out.

2. Obtain Certifications

Certifications such as the⁤ National Association of Legal Assistants (NALA)​ Certified⁤ Paralegal can boost your​ credibility.

3. Customize Your⁢ resume ​and ⁢Cover​ Letter

Highlight your experience in criminal ⁢law, attention to detail, and organizational skills tailored to the specific vacancy.

4.Develop Strong Legal Research Skills

proficiency in legal databases‌ like ⁤LexisNexis and Westlaw is highly valued.

5. network Within the Legal ⁤Community

Join​ local legal associations,attend ⁣seminars,and⁢ participate in online forums related ‌to criminal law.

First-Hand Experience: A Day in⁣ the ⁤Life of a Criminal ⁢Paralegal

Understanding what a typical day looks like can help you decide if this career suits you.A criminal paralegal’s day may involve:

  • Reviewing police reports and evidence
  • Drafting legal documents for upcoming hearings
  • Attending court sessions alongside attorneys
  • Interviewing witnesses or ‍clients under supervision
  • Conducting legal research on relevant statutes and ⁢case law

The role requires a blend of analytical skills, attention to detail, ⁢and resilience, especially when dealing with sensitive criminal cases.
